Report: Zaza accepts Wolfsburg
By Football Italia staff
Simone Zaza visited the Wolfsburg training ground today and has reportedly agreed to the €25m transfer from Juventus.
The two clubs worked out a fee of €25m, but the striker was unsure about leaving Serie A for the Bundesliga.
Multiple reports suggest he flew out on a private jet to visit the Wolfsburg ground, facilities and squad today.
According to Sky Sport Italia, Zaza was sufficiently impressed to accept the move to Germany.
The former Sassuolo centre-forward had also been heavily linked with West Ham United, but wanted to remain in Italy.
Zaza was left out of the squad for tonight's friendly against Espanyol at the Stadio Braglia in Modena.

Inter target staying in Brazil until January amid Leicester interest
Santos want to keep hold of Gabigol until the end of the Brazilian season, as they look for a first league title since 2004...
Inter have been dealt a blow in their pursuit of Brazil striker Gabriel ‘Gabigol’ Barbosa, after Santos insisted he would remain with them until January, paving the way for Leicester City to enter the fray.
The forward has been the target of a number of European clubs, including Juventus and Atletico Madrid, after taking Brazilian domestic football by storm, although Inter are thought to be in advanced negotiations for his signature.
However, Santos coach Dorival Junior is keen to hold on to Gabigol until the end of the season in Brazil, due to conclude in December, allowing the 19-year-old to move in the winter transfer window.
It would follow the same manner as fellow Brazil forward Gabriel Jesus’ move to Manchester City, with the Palmeiras starlet set to join up in January.
“If a deal has to be done, it would be less damaging to our plans for us to lose him in January,” Dorival Junior claimed. “We should find the same arrangement as Palmeiras did with Gabriel Jesus.”
Meanwhile, the delay could allow Premier League champions Leicester to push ahead to the front of the queue for Gabigol, with the Foxes keen to bring in more firepower for the defence of their title.
The striker is currently on international duty at the Olympic Games on home soil with Brazil and was in deadly form in the hosts’ most recent fixture, netting twice in a 4-0 win over Denmark.

Juve: Fabregas or Brozovic?
By Football Italia staff
Today’s Italian papers claim Juventus are targeting either Chelsea’s Cesc Fabregas or Inter man Marcelo Brozovic for their midfield.
The Bianconeri need a replacement for Paul Pogba, especially as Claudio Marchisio is out with a knee injury until October or November.
Tuttosport suggest this morning that Fabregas is in pole position, as Coach Max Allegri has been trying to sign him up since his days on the Milan bench.
Chelsea would be more prepared to let the Spaniard leave than first choice Nemanja Matic, as Antonio Conte publicly locked down the Serbian in a Press conference yesterday.
He only moved from Barcelona to Chelsea in July 2014 for €33m, having previously spent eight years at Arsenal.
However, the Corriere dello Sport’s front page insists that Brozovic is the main target to take over from Pogba.
The Croatia international is only 23 years old and arrived from Dinamo Zagreb in January 2015 for just €8m.
He impressed at Euro 2016 and in Serie A last season, but his agent has complained at low wages at San Siro.
Inter are very unlikely to sell one of their most promising young talents to rivals Juventus, but a €30m offer might prove hard to resist.
Brozovic certainly does not have the international experience of Fabregas, but is six years younger, more affordable and more versatile, as he can play in several different midfield roles.

Juventus and Watford Reach Agreement For Pereyra...
After weeks of negotiating it seems Juventus and Watford have come to an agreement for Roberto Pereyra.
According to Sky Sports UK, Watford and Juventus have finally found a fee that works for both of them in regards to Pereyra. The Premier League side will reportedly pay 15 million euros for the former Udinese man and will acquire him outright. Before the transfer becomes official, however, Pereyra must find an agreement with Watford. In the coming days the parties will meet in order to hash out an agreement.
